How we work — the engagement shape

One offer. The Marketing Engine Pilot. Six workflows. Eight weeks. Yours to keep on day 31. Fixed scope, fixed price, fixed time. The shape never changes.

StepWhat happensTime / price
1. Fit call20 minutes, no proposal. Qualifies both ways.Free
2. Paid discovery2 hours. Scope locked, written. Credited against the pilot fee if you sign.AED 3k (waived for the founder pilot)
3. ProposalScope + price in writing. Three options usually: lean / standard / extended retainer.
4. Sign + deposit70% on signature for the first three clients (UAE payment caution), 30% on handover.
5. Audit + discoveryWeeks 1–2. Map your stack, your team, your funnel. Lock the six workflows.Included
6. Build + connectWeeks 3–6. Install workflows, connect to existing tools, test on real data.Included
7. Train + handoverWeeks 7–8. One team member runs every workflow. Documentation. Nothing locked to me.Included
8. Day 31 onwardsOptional retainer for monitoring + tweaks. You can fire me. Everything stays on your accounts.AED 7k / month optional

The capacity cap is two active builds at any time. Year-one realistic target: 8–12 engagements at AED 55k = AED 440k–660k plus stacking retainers. The cap matters more than the top line — overcommitting kills delivery quality, kills the case-study pipeline, kills the brand.

Who we work with — and who we don't

Tier 1 — first calls

Real estate brokerages, 5–30 agents. Lead cost AED 450–900. Industry response time four-plus hours; best practice five minutes; lift 21× qualified. Ninety percent of conversations on WhatsApp. Owners have cash from commissions, no ops capacity to deploy it.

Aesthetic clinics, dental, cosmetic surgery. Patient LTV AED 15–25k. Heavy ad spend, terrible follow-up. Owner-operated, Instagram-driven. Recover 20 lost patients a year × AED 18k = AED 360k. The engagement pays for itself.

Boutique real estate developers — not Emaar. Off-plan launches need segmented landing pages. Bigger budgets, slower cycle, bigger fees. Generic landing page at 1.2% conversion vs segmented at 2.5% on 100k visitors = 1,300 extra qualified leads × 0.5% close × AED 80k commission = AED 520k.

Tier 2 — later

Education / training (bilingual, seasonal, slow). Interior design / fit-out (project-based, smaller volume). Hospitality groups (booking-driven, thinner margins).

Tier 3 — avoid

Anyone with a procurement department. Regulated buyers where procurement kills SMB-priced offers (except direct relationships like the GIG engagement). Generic e-commerce where it's an agency price war. Retail with margins too thin to pay for a pilot.

The founder pilot

One-time arrangement. The first agent or operator who lets me publish the install as a case study gets the pilot free in exchange for case-study rights. Specifically: one written case study on articulate-ai.work, one paragraph of testimonial, and a 15-minute video walkthrough on camera of what changed. Filled by BossCouple, May 2026.

Subsequent engagements price at AED 55k. The founder-pilot client is named publicly as such — it's a "first 100 customers" badge, not a "we'll work for free" precedent.

Firewall against blur: if the founder-pilot client wants the scope to expand across their wider organisation, that scale-up is priced commercially. The founder pilot covers the original named install only.
